Output f2652637a16c9e6643e07c266024b3dbbaf94ed62cc1443d7eb70dc1b7764fef:0

value
1051408
script pubkey
OP_0 OP_PUSHBYTES_20 44e07507f76208eb09ce4c867bf37700a6a20efd
address
bc1qgns82plhvgywkzwwfjr8humhqzn2yrhaaxf4rs
transaction
f2652637a16c9e6643e07c266024b3dbbaf94ed62cc1443d7eb70dc1b7764fef
spent
true